Summary of differences between chocolate ice cream and brisket raw

  • Chocolate ice cream has more calcium, while brisket raw has more vitamin B12, zinc, vitamin B6, selenium, vitamin B3, phosphorus, iron, and choline.
  • Brisket raw covers your daily need for vitamin B12, 89% more than chocolate ice cream.
  • Chocolate ice cream contains 22 times more calcium than brisket raw. While chocolate ice cream contains 109mg of calcium, brisket raw contains only 5mg.
  • The amount of saturated fat in brisket raw is lower.
  • Brisket raw has a lower glycemic index. The glycemic index of brisket raw is 0, while the glycemic index of chocolate ice cream is 62.

These are the specific foods used in this comparison Ice creams, chocolate and Beef, brisket, whole, separable lean only, all grades, raw.
